The Clovis East Timberwolves will head out on the road to square off against the Central East Bengals at 3:30 p.m. on Friday. Clovis East is strutting in with some hitting muscle as they've averaged 6.3 runs per game this season.
On Tuesday, Clovis East made easy work of Clovis and carried off an 11-1 win. The Timberwolves haven't had any issues with the Cougars recently, as the game was their fifth consecutive victory against them.
Chloe Solis spent all six innings played on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ered only one earned run on two hits and racked up 11 Ks.

On the hitting side, Clovis East let Chloe Wolfe and Gabriella Valdez run wild. Wolfe got on base in all four of her plate appearances with two runs, one triple, and one double, while Valdez went a perfect 4-for-4 with one stolen base, two RBI, and one run. Those four hits gave Valdez a new career-high. Another player making a difference was Madeleine Larralde, who went a perfect 3-for-3 with two runs and one stolen base.
Clovis East was getting hits left and right and finished the game having posted a batting average of .464. That's the best batting average they've posted all season.
Clovis North hit Central East with a five-run fifth inning on Tuesday, which goes a long way in explaining the final result. The Bengals lost 13-1 to the Broncos. The Bengals have now taken an 'L' in back-to-back games.
Clovis East's win bumped their record up to 18-3. As for Central East, their loss dropped their record down to 5-21.
Everything went Clovis East's way against Central East in their previous matchup back in April, as Clovis East made off with a 12-3 victory. The rematch might be a little tougher for the Timberwolves since the team won't have the home-field adv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
